- Operate and maintain equipment used in the manufacturing process, ensuring proper functionality and adherence to safety protocols.
- Follow standard operating procedures (SOPs) and batch records to accurately produce and document products.
- Complete necessary paperwork and documentation accurately and in a timely manner.
- Monitor and maintain inventory levels of raw materials and finished products.
- Troubleshoot equipment and process issues to ensure efficient and high-quality production.
- Collaborate with team members and supervisors to identify and implement process improvements.
- Ensure compliance with all regulatory guidelines and company policies.
- Maintain a clean and organized work environment to uphold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P).
- Participate in training and development opportunities to expand knowledge and skills.
- Communicate effectively with team members and management to provide updates on production status and any issues that arise.
- Adhere to production schedules and meet production targets to ensure timely delivery of products.
- Follow safety protocols and report any safety hazards or incidents to supervisors immediately.
- Maintain confidentiality of all proprietary information and trade secrets.
- Continuously seek ways to improve efficiency and productivity in the manufacturing process.
- Demonstrate a strong commitment to quality and ensure products meet all specifications and standards.
High School Diploma Or Equivalent: A Manufacturing Associate At Catalent Should Have At Least A High School Diploma Or Ged Equivalent To Demonstrate A Basic Level Of Education And Critical Thinking Skills.
Previous Manufacturing Experience: Candidates Should Have Prior Experience Working In A Manufacturing Environment, Preferably In The Pharmaceutical Or Biotechnology Industry. This Experience Will Demonstrate A Familiarity With Manufacturing Processes, Equipment, And Quality Control Procedures.
Attention To Detail: The Role Of A Manufacturing Associate Requires A High Level Of Attention To Detail To Ensure Accuracy And Precision In Production Processes. Candidates Should Possess Strong Organizational Skills And Be Able To Follow Strict Protocols And Procedures.
Ability To Work In A Team: Manufacturing Associates At Catalent Will Work As Part Of A Team, And Therefore Should Have Strong Interpersonal Skills And The Ability To Communicate Effectively With Team Members And Supervisors. The Ability To Collaborate And Work Well With Others Is Essential For Success In This Role.
Physical Stamina And Flexibility: The Role Of A Manufacturing Associate Can Involve Long Periods Of Standing, Lifting, And Repetitive Tasks. Candidates Should Be Physically Fit And Able To Perform These Tasks For Extended Periods. Flexibility In Work Schedule And Ability To Work Overtime Or Weekends May Also Be Required.

Catalent, Inc. is a multinational corporation headquartered in Somerset, New Jersey. It is a global provider of delivery technologies, development, drug manufacturing, biologics, gene therapies and consumer health products. It employs more than 14,000 people, including approximately 2,400 scientists and technicians.
